Best Comfort Height Toilets (Sit Easily) 3 Reviews in 2022 – Toiletable

Last updated: Jun 20th, 2022 by Tyler White

Traditional toilets are 15-inches high, but what if you’re looking for a taller option to accommodate a disability of tall family members? Comfort height toilets are the answer! These are typically 17-19 inches high and are becoming a popular choice in homes because of the increased comfort (it’s not just a clever name!).

Four Types of Comfort-Height Toilets

When buying a comfort-height toilet, you can choose between four basic options.

  • Close-Coupled

           Similar to casual units but offer a taller height. 

  • Back-to-Wall Models

    Toilets which are fitted firmly against both the floor and wall, are also available with extended height for improved comfort.

  • Combination WC Units

    Connect to the concealing cistern, also come with a seat height greater than 17 inches.

  • Low-Level Units

    Comes with a cistern positioned slightly above the pan, were previously unavailable in comfort height, however, you can now find these units with comfort-height seats.

Comfort Height Toilet | Buying Guide

In this section, we provide you with many topics to help make the proper choice when choosing your next comfort height toilet for your home.

Comfort Height Description

Simply put, a comfort height toilet is a toilet that follows ADA standards. These types of toilets are known for their chair height, which is 17 inches or higher. Thanks to their elevated height, these toilets are great options for disabled persons, tall persons, and the elderly.

convenient height toilets are 5" taller than standard height

You can find Comfort Height toilets in a variety of sizes – 17 inches, 19 inches, or even higher. No matter the final size, if the toilet is “comfort height”, it’ll be comfortable and easy to use.

Eco-Friendly

Many comfort height toilets are eco-friendly, but not all. If you want to reduce monthly bills and still have a toilet with a powerful flush, look for models that include eco-friendly features. For example, any toilet with EPA WaterSense certification is a great environmentally-conscious choice.

Toilets with EPA WaterSense certification meet standards set in the US and Canada to save water and encourage water efficiency. Those toilets also have a lower gallon-per-flush rate to directly lower your monthly bills without compromising the performance.

Flushing Capabilities

No matter which comfort height toilet you intend to buy, always consider its flush capabilities. There are a few key types to consider: 

  • Dual-Flush Feature

    This feature allows you to choose between two flush options depending on whether the waste is solid or liquid. By using the lower consumption flush option for liquid waste, you’ll see a big difference in your water consumption over time. 

  • Gravity Flush

    This flush option is seen in most traditional toilets. As the name suggests, it uses gravity and water weight to make enough pressure to execute the flush. Among all the flushing systems, the Gravity Flush has been around the longest.

  • Pressure-Assisted Flush

    While similar to the Gravity Flush, this option offers a higher flow rate, making it more effective than gravity flush systems. However, pressure-assisted flushes can be quite loud, so if you want a quiet toilet, this option might not be ideal for you.

  • Tornado Flush (or Double Cyclone)

    This option is a flushing system made by TOTO company. Thanks to advanced technology, this system offers an incredibly efficient flush that removes all waste in a single flush while only consuming 1.28 gallons per flush.

Installation Process

Installation of a comfort height toilet depends mainly on your experience and your skills. Removing the old toilet and installing a new one is labor-intensive, and requires some plumbing knowledge to execute perfectly. 

Another installation factor to consider is whether the toilet is one-piece or two-piece. Two-piece toilets have a separate bowl and a tank that you need to connect. These require some extra steps during installation, which adds complexity, but one-piece toilets are also much heavier by comparison. 

Finally, some toilets come with parts that you will have to install or buy separately. Depending on your personal comfort level, plumbing experience, and the toilet itself, you may want to consider calling a professional to help with the installation of your new toilet. 

What to Avoid

These are some of the things that you should avoid when buying a comfort-height toilet:

  • Non-standard Replacement Parts: Some people prefer toilets that defy the ordinary, from custom seats to unique construction parts. However, you should always think about the cost of replacing those parts before deciding to invest in a new and unique component
  • Slamming lid: One way to improve the user experience is using a SoftClose toilet seat. These seats minimize accidental slamming of the toilet seat, which can be disruptive particularly at night. Additionally,  slamming the lid many times can lead to cracking or breaking, which SoftClose toilet seats help avoid
  • Toilet Size: Particularly for comfort height toilets with an elongated bowl, be sure to measure the space and ensure you’ll have enough room when using the toilet. The added height provides a lot more comfortable but may require more space in your bathroom than previous toilets, particularly if this is your first comfort height toilet purchase. 
  • Low-Quality Construction: While it’s possible to buy a toilet for less than $100, be extremely cautious of any toilet with too low of a price. A toilet is something that you will be using for years, so it’s smart to invest in a high-quality unit. If you choose a cheap or low-quality option, you may end up spending more on repairs and replacement parts in the long run.
  • Hard to Clean Construction: Two-piece models have a separate bowl and tank, and often have many nooks and crannies that can be difficult to clean. If you are a busy person who can’t spend much time cleaning the toilet, it’s a nice idea to buy a one-piece unit which minimizes tricky cleaning areas

Deciding Factors

While purchasing a comfort height toilet, it is a good idea to look for a model that is ADA compliant. The standard ADA requirement for seat heights is 17 to 19 inches from the floor to the top of the toilet seat.

Additionally, if you are an environmental-friendly person, opt for an eco-friendly product to help reduce water consumption.. Further, if the model is EPA WaterSense certified, you could be eligible for rebates on your water bills.

When making your choice, pick a toilet that will fit perfectly with the rest of your bathroom aesthetically. It’s also important to consider the material, flushing mechanism, and whether it’s a single or two-piece model, which impacts installation.

Ultimately, models with additional height can be used by both residential and commercial users.
